I don't understand why I should be excited about this knife. I currently have an Endura and a G10 Police. This new knife will only have a blade that is 0.3" longer than my Police knife. I would love to be wrong. But, I don't see what it has to offer that the G10 Police can't. The blade needed to be at least 5" long.

I currently EDC carry a Rajah II with a 6" blade. I would trade in a heartbeat to a Spyderco knife if they made a large knife. I like Coldsteel. But, Spyderco knives are day and night superior in quality to CS. I don't understand why they let Coldsteel own this market? The Szabo just isn't big enough.

P.S. I carry a 6" folder because California does not have a limitation on the length of a folding blade concealed. Carrying a fixed blade concealed is a felony. And, my current county does not offer CCW. So, a big folding knife is my best defensive choice.

I like the look of the Szabo but I have to agree that ,as I indicated somewhere above, the blade should have been longer to put the Szabo into truly big folder terrritory.
Cold Steel does indeed stand virtually alone when it comes to really big folders although I think Sog does deserve an honourable mention for the 5" bladed Pentagon elite 2 and the Spec-elite 2.
I have most of CS's XL folders but one I don't have yet is the 6" blade Hold-out 1. When the Szabo is released I'm really going to have to think hard if I want to pay about a $100 for the 6" CS or [I think] about twice that for the Szabo which isn't much longer than my Police 3.
 
The problem with the SOG knives is that there is nothing to keep your hand from moving forward onto the blade if you hit something hard.

And every pentagon/spec elite I've handled has significant up and down blade play. I keep an eye out for them at gun shows and blade shows to try to find one without blade play, because I like the overall design of it. Maybe I've just had bad luck...
 
I really don't think SOG nor Cold Steel should be mentioned as comparisons to this knife. This is in a class of it's own and is going to be a high quality taichung model with insane fit and finish.
